41 C.F.R. § 102.37.340 — When may a SASP terminate a cooperative agreement?

§ 102–37.340 When may a SASP terminate a cooperative agreement? You may terminate a cooperative agreement with GSA 60-calendar days after providing GSA with written notice. For other cooperative agreements with other authorized parties, you or the other party may terminate the agreement as mutually agreed.
